HomeMy WebLinkAboutC.054.93009_0342 (2)Section 3. From the canvass made, this Board does hereby
determine and certify:
(a) That 51,060 voters were registered and qualified to vote.
(b) That at said referendum 8,190 votes were cast for the
order adopted on August 26, 1993, authorizing not exceeding
$36,285,000 School Bonds of the County of Iredell, North Carolina,
for the purpose of providing funds, together with any other
available funds, in the amount of $29,480,000 to the Iredell-
Statesville School Administrative Unit for the construction of a
new South Iredell High School and a new South Iredell Elementary
School, the construction of additions to and renovations of
Statesville High School, West Iredell High School, North Iredell
High School and Central School, and the construction of additions
and improvements to existing school facilities, and in the amount
of $6,805,000 to the Mooresville School Administrative Unit for the
construction of a new elementary school and the renovation of the
existing high school, including, in each case, the acquisition of
any necessary land, furnishings and equipment therefor, and
authorizing the levy of taxes in an amount sufficient to pay the
principal of and the interest on said bonds, and 10,025 votes were
cast against said order, and that a majority of the qualified
voters of said County who voted thereon at said referendum having
voted against of the approval of said order, said order was thereby
not approved.
